On 2019/06/05 12:42, Murphy Zhou wrote:
> Now the tests are running in MOUNTPOINT without it mounted.
> Fails on ext2:
Hi Murphy,
Did you get EOPNOTSUPP when running preadv203 on ext2?
It seems OK to running preadv203 on ext2, as below:
--------------------------------------------------------
tst_test.c:1172: INFO: Testing on ext2
tst_mkfs.c:90: INFO: Formatting /dev/loop0 with ext2 opts='' extra opts=''
mke2fs 1.44.3 (10-July-2018)
tst_test.c:1111: INFO: Timeout per run is 0h 05m 00s
preadv203.c:145: INFO: Number of full_reads 751044, short reads 10, zero
len reads 0, EAGAIN(s) 67021
preadv203.c:180: INFO: Number of writes 1087560
preadv203.c:194: INFO: Cache dropped 149 times
preadv203.c:223: PASS: Got some EAGAIN
-------------------------------------------------------
BTW: I got EOPNOTSUPP when running preadv203 on tmpfs. :-)
Best Regards,
Xiao Yang
> preadv203.c does not set mount_device, which makes BROK:
> preadv203.c:122: BROK: preadv2() failed: EOPNOTSUPP
>
> Signed-off-by: Murphy Zhou <jencce.kernel@gmail.com>
> ---
> testcases/kernel/syscalls/preadv2/preadv203.c | 1 +
> 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+)
>
> diff --git a/testcases/kernel/syscalls/preadv2/preadv203.c b/testcases/kernel/syscalls/preadv2/preadv203.c
> index 810d1e8db..e4f68a51b 100644
> --- a/testcases/kernel/syscalls/preadv2/preadv203.c
> +++ b/testcases/kernel/syscalls/preadv2/preadv203.c
> @@ -261,6 +261,7 @@ static struct tst_test test = {
> .cleanup = cleanup,
> .test_all = verify_preadv2,
> .mntpoint = MNTPOINT,
> + .mount_device = 1,
> .all_filesystems = 1,
> .needs_tmpdir = 1,
> .needs_root = 1,
